Hibernate的所有的操作都是通過Session完成的. 基本步驟如下: 1:通過配置文件得到SessionFactory: SessionFactory sessionFactory=new Configuration().configure ...
測試數據庫如下 t sort表: t good表: 一 對象導航方式查詢 查詢所有食品類下面的食品 代碼: 查詢結果: 二 OID查詢 OID查詢就是根據id查詢某一條記錄 代碼 結果 三 HQL查詢 hql查詢是使用Hibernate Query Language進行的一種查詢方式,在這種查詢方式中必須要寫hql語句才能查詢。 查詢所有 查詢所有的hql語句格式為:from 實體類名稱 以查詢所 ...
2017-06-06 17:30 5 30789 推薦指數:
Hibernate的所有的操作都是通過Session完成的. 基本步驟如下: 1:通過配置文件得到SessionFactory: SessionFactory sessionFactory=new Configuration().configure ...
Hibernate查詢所有數據的操作方式有三種。 1、Query (1)使用該方法查詢時,不需要編寫sql語句,但是需要編寫hql(Hibernate Query Language)語句,該語句是Hibernate查詢語言。 (2)hql語言操作的是實體類和實體類的屬性 ...
這篇主要簡單間接 hibernate查詢 1.數據庫操作中最重要的是查詢,Hibernate提供了多種查詢方式來幫助程序員快速實現查詢功能。 有hql,本地sql查詢,Criteria查詢,example, oid等。 2.Hql 查詢:Hql :hibernate query ...
我用的數據庫是MySQL,實體類叫User 1.Hibernate添加數據操作 2.Hibernate刪除數據操作 3.Hibernate修改數據操作 4.Hibernate查詢數據操作 5.Hibernate增刪 ...
總結 1.HQL (Hibernate Query Language) 語法類似sql 把sql語句的表名換成了類名,把字段名換成實體類中的屬性 具有跨數據庫的優點 2.QBC (Query By Criteria) 這種方式比較 面向對象方式,重點是有三個描述條件 ...
在web項目中,顯示數據一般采用分頁顯示的,在分頁的同時,用戶可能還有搜索的需求,也就是模糊查詢,所以,我們要在dao寫一個可以分頁並且可以動態加條件查詢的方法。分頁比較簡單,采用hibernate提供的分頁,動態條件采用map(“字段”,模糊值)封裝查詢條件,map可以添加多個查詢條件,是個不錯 ...
creteria的創建是依賴session的,使用session.createCriteria來創建。 查詢條件一般是由web頁面傳遞過來的,查詢條件由web層傳給service層,再傳遞給dao層,組裝查詢條件到Criteria執行查詢,這樣執行的話,前端的每一種查詢都需要有對應的dao查詢 ...
package com.test; import com.domain.Customer; import com.utils.HibernateUtils; import org.hibernate.SQLQuery; import org.hibernate ...